Spike Lee and Denzel Washington's New Interpretation of a Classic
The Power Duo: Lee and Washington's Cinematic Reunion
Spike Lee and Denzel Washington have a long history of creating cinema that resonates deeply with audiences worldwide. Known for their iconic collaborations in films like "Malcolm X" and "He Got Game," the duo now ventures into new territory by adapting Akira Kurosawa's 1963 thriller, "High and Low." This reinterpretation promises intense drama, socio-political themes, and breathtaking performances.

What Makes "High and Low" A Timely Adaptation?
Originally directed by the legendary Akira Kurosawa, "High and Low" explored the dichotomy between social classes with a suspenseful narrative twist. Lee's adaptation is set against the backdrop of contemporary socio-political dynamics, drawing stark parallels to today's societal issues.

The Cinematic Mastery of Spike Lee
Spike Lee is renowned for his ability to fuse storytelling with impactful visuals. In this adaptation, expect his usual creative techniques — such as the double dolly shot and vibrant color palettes — to be seamlessly integrated with the film's dark and gritty themes. Known for emphasizing societal issues, Lee adds depth and dimension to Kurosawa's narrative, making it resonate with contemporary audiences.
